The hotel rate-parity checker now normalizes currencies before comparison, eliminating the false mismatches seen on cross-border listings. Scrape intervals for low-traffic properties were relaxed from hourly to every four hours to cut quota usage. A tolerance threshold of 0.5% was introduced so rounding differences no longer trigger alerts; it is configurable per property group. Historical mismatch records were left untouched. Questions about threshold tuning or the normalization table should go to the maintainer named below.

named custodian: Brivan Eliath Quenox Frador

Ticket #—locked vault, fuel report pipeline

The Harstell fleet fuel-usage report failed overnight. Cause: the credentials vault auto-locked after three bad unlock attempts by the batch runner. Dax rotated the runner token; report regenerated fine. For the eng sync: unlock flow needs a retry cap fix. Recovery passphrase for the vault follows.

vault phrase of bagaf-kajeg = jorath-feniel-briir-siliel-ralix

Handover note — Garage Feed (Deck 4, Larkmoor Centre)

Rhea, I'm passing the occupancy feed service to you ahead of the security review. It polls the bay sensors every 20 seconds, aggregates per level, and publishes counts to the signage broker. Auth between the poller and broker uses mutual TLS; certs rotate quarterly. No raw camera data touches this service, only sensor counts. The current production configuration values, exactly as deployed on the Larkmoor edge node, are listed below.

config for tagep-yajef:
ulawyn:
  log_level: error
  metrics_host: metrics.ulawyn.lumiclabs.internal
  pin: 0564
  pool_size: 32